- Day 1
Luang Prabang
You'll be picked up at the airport and taken straight to your hotel to get settled. From there, head out to see some of the key temples around Luang Prabang, stopping by Wat Visoun and Wat Mai. Later in the afternoon, make your way up Mount Phousi where you'll find the sacred stupa and get views across the city and down to the Mekong River, especially nice as the sun starts to set. After that, grab dinner or walk through the Night Market to look at handmade textiles and crafts from local artisans.

- Day 2
Luang Prabang
Early on, if you're interested, you can watch monks collecting alms in the morning, which is something you'll really only see in Laos. Then head to Phosi Market for breakfast and local goods. From there, check out Wat Sene, the city's oldest temple, and Wat Xiengthong which is quite beautiful. A boat takes you upstream on the Mekong to Pak Ou Caves, where thousands of gold Buddha statues line the caves. Stop at Ban Xanghai to try local rice wine and Ban Phanom for weaving demonstrations. In the afternoon, visit Kuangsi Waterfall for a swim and walk through the forest, see a few local ethnic villages, and stop at Ban Xangkhong to see silk weavings and traditional paper making. Finish the day watching the sunset from Wat Siphouthabath.

- Day 3
Luang Prabang to Vientiane
Start in the morning at the National Museum, housed in the former Royal Palace, where you can look at artifacts related to Lao culture and history. Spend some time browsing the Central Market before heading to the airport for your flight to Vientiane. Once you arrive, walk through the capital's main temples including Wat Sisaket, which has thousands of miniature Buddha statues inside, and Wat Prakeo, the former royal temple that once held the Emerald Buddha. Take photos at Patuxay Monument, Vientiane's version of the Arc de Triomphe, then visit That Luang Stupa which is considered sacred. Later, head down to the Mekong Riverside to watch the sunset and explore what the city has going on in the evening.
